Comparing Court Sizes: NBA vs. FIBA
The regular NBA court steps ninety four ft (28.65 meters) in length and fifty toes (15.24 meters) in width. This is actually the court size found in arenas like the Staples Centre or Madison Sq. Backyard garden, in which many of the world’s major gamers showcase their expertise. In contrast, a FIBA-controlled courtroom is 28 meters (about ninety one.86 ft) very long and 15 meters (roughly forty nine.21 ft) wide. This means that the FIBA courtroom is roughly two feet shorter in size and just under one foot narrower in width when compared to the NBA court.
Nevertheless these discrepancies could seem minimal, they Perform an important position in how basketball games are played in The 2 methods. A lesser courtroom frequently signifies less Room to work, which impacts participant motion, spacing, and sport tempo.

Other Essential Discrepancies: A few-Place Line and Vital Area
Along with the court dimension, other dimensional distinctions exist among NBA and FIBA courts that influence the type of Perform. As an example, the three-stage line in the NBA is ready at 23.seventy five ft (7.24 meters) at the top of your arc and 22 toes (6.7 meters) in the corners. FIBA’s three-level line is actually a uniform 6.seventy five meters (22.15 feet) throughout. This shorter distance in FIBA tends to make a few-tips marginally simpler to aim and sometimes encourages a lot more frequent exterior capturing.
The paint area or “vital” also differs a bit. The NBA makes use of an oblong essential which is sixteen feet large, even though FIBA courts switched from a trapezoidal critical to a rectangular just one in 2010, by using a width very near to the NBA’s standard. On the other hand, defensive principles like the NBA’s “defensive 3-next violation” are absent in FIBA, affecting how defenses defend the paint.
